So, what's the deal with the **Dutch Flat weather**? Well, first off, Dutch Flat, California, experiences a Mediterranean climate, meaning h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ters. This is something to keep in mind when packing your bags or planning activities. Generally, you can expect sunshine and warm temperatures during the summer months, making it ideal for hiking, exploring the outdoors, and enjoying the local scenery. But the weather can be a bit unpredictable, as it is in many mountain areas! It's always a good idea to check the forecast before heading out. During the winter, you can expect cooler temperatures and the possibility of rain or snow. This is the perfect time for skiing, snowboarding, or simply cozying up by a fire. The average annual temperature hovers around the mid-50s Fahrenheit, with summer highs often reaching the 80s and winter lows dipping into the 30s. Of course, these are just averages, and the actual weather can vary day to day and even hour by hour. Always consult a reliable weather source for the most current forecast.
